    Abstract: A system and method for determining a quantitative measure of search efficiency of related Web pages. An information goal is specified. A target Web page is identified within a plurality of Web pages. The information goal is searched via a search function in the Web pages to identify potential Web pages that include at least one hyperlink referencing and proximal cues relating to distal content included in another potential Web page. An activation network is formed. A directed graph is built, including nodes corresponding to the potential Web pages and arcs corresponding to the hyperlinks. A weight is assigned to each arc to represent a probability of traversal of the corresponding hyperlink based on a relatedness of keywords in the information goal to the proximal cues. A traversal through the activation network to the node corresponding to the target Web page is evaluated as a quantitative measure of search efficiency.

    Abstract: A method and system for autonomic relevancy building using information obtained from clients to improve customer support. Upon receiving a client request for product support information, product support information objects representing the requested product support information in an information library are identified. Relevant product support information corresponding to the identified relevant product support information objects are provided to the client. Data regarding whether or not the information provided to the client is relevant may be obtained from the client through implicit feedback (such as, system usage), explicit feedback (such as, user feedback), metadata information, or any combination thereof. Relevancy associations may be created between the product support information objects based on the relevancy data. Relevancy weights may also be assigned to each relevancy association based on the relevancy data, wherein the relevancy weights designate a certainty of each relevancy association.
